Copper fin tubes are commonly used in various industrial applications due to their excellent heat transfer properties. When choosing copper fin tubecopper fin tubes for a specific application, there are several key factors to consider.
First and foremost, it is important to consider the material of the copper fin tube. Copper is a popular choice due to its high thermal conductivity, corrosion resistance, and durability. However, there are different grades of copper available, each with its own set of properties. It is important to select the grade that best suits the specific requirements of the application.
Another important factor to consider is the fin design of the copper fin tube. The fin design plays a crucial role in determining the heat transfer efficiency of the tube. There are various fin designs available, including plain fins, serrated fins, and louvered fins. The choice of fin design should be based on the desired heat transfer performance and pressure drop requirements.
Additionally, the size and shape of the copper fin tube should be carefully considered. The dimensions of the tube, such as diameter, length, and wall thickness, will impact the heat transfer capabilities of the tube. It is important to select the right size and shape of the tube to ensure optimal performance in the given application.
Recommended article:Furthermore, it is essential to consider the manufacturing quality of the copper fin tube. High-quality manufacturing processes, such as seamless tube production and precision fin forming, can significantly impact the performance and longevity of the tube. It is important to choose a reputable manufacturer with a proven track record of producing high-quality copper fin tubes.
In conclusion, when choosing copper fin tubes for an industrial application, it is crucial to consider factors such as material selection, fin design, size and shape, and manufacturing quality. By carefully evaluating these factors and selecting the optimal copper fin tube, it is possible to ensure efficient heat transfer and long-lasting performance in the intended application. Choosing the right copper fin tube can make a significant impact on the overall effectiveness and productivity of industrial processes.
